Rescue Operation Halts Train Traffic and More Emergency Reports

A series of incidents disrupted travel across southern Germany on Monday. A rescue operation at Heddesheim/Hirschberg station caused partial railway closures, while a theft at Karlsruhe’s main station led to an arrest. Meanwhile, a violent altercation on a Stuttgart train and a tram collision in Munich added to the day’s disruptions.

Early on Monday, a 22-year-old man had his travel bag stolen at Karlsruhe’s main station. Police arrested a suspect hours later and charged them with theft. No further details about the perpetrator have been released.

Later in the day, a rescue operation at Heddesheim/Hirschberg station forced the closure of all tracks. As a result, regional trains from Frankfurt terminated at Weinheim, while those from Heidelberg ended at Ladenburg. Long-distance services were rerouted via the Riedbahn to avoid major delays. A replacement bus service was also set up between Weinheim and Ladenburg stations. On Monday evening, a physical altercation broke out on an S2 line train between Stuttgart-Vaihingen and Schwabstraße. Four teenagers had been harassing passengers when a 52-year-old man intervened. One of the teenagers then assaulted the man, who responded by placing the attacker in a headlock. Federal police are now investigating both the teenager and the 52-year-old. In Munich, a woman suffered serious injuries after colliding with a tram. The tram operator and other passengers were unharmed in the incident.

The incidents led to temporary travel disruptions, with replacement services and rerouted trains minimising delays. Authorities continue to investigate the assault on the Stuttgart train, while the injured woman in Munich remains under medical care. No further updates on the Karlsruhe theft have been provided.
